Another great composition. Your point of view is very good, the photo wouldn't be that good had you taken it from eye level. The reflection of the building across is fantastic, as others already mentioned the left site is overexposed, I would suggest next time you expose for highlights and recover the details in the shadows in photo shop. Once you overexpose there isn't much you can do with this, shadows are easier to recover.
